BELTSVILLE RESEARCH CENTER For general administrative purposes, including maintenance, oper- ation, repairs, and other expenses, $86,620; and, in addition thereto, this appropriation may be augmented, by transfer of funds or by reimbursement, from applicable appropriations, to cover the cost, including handling and other related charges, of services and sup- plies, equipment and materials furnished, stores of which may be maintained at the Center, and to cover the cost of building construc- tion, alteration, and repair performed by the Center in carrying out the purposes of such applicable appropriations and the applicable appropriations may also be charged their proportionate share of the necessary general expenses of the Center not covered by this appropriation. INTERCHANGE OF APPROPRIATIONS Not to exceed 5 per centum of the foregoing amounts for the miscel- laneous expenses of the work of any bureau, division, or office herein provided for shall be available interchangeably for expenditures on the objects included within the general expenses of such bureau division, or office, but no more than 5 per centum shall be added to any one item of appropriation except in cases of extraordinary emergency. WORK FOR OTHER DEPARTMENTS During the fiscal year for which appropriations are herein made the head of any department or independent establishment of the Government requiring inspections, analyses, and tests of food and other products, within the scope of the functions of the Department of Agriculture and which that department is unable to perform within the limits of its appropriations, may, with the approval of the Secretary of Agriculture transfer to the Department of Agri- culture for direct expenditure such sums as may be necessary for the performance of such work.
